Overactive bladder (OAB) and nocturia, characterized by constant urination during the evening, can dramatically interrupt your sleep and general lifestyle. These urinary problems usually bring about disruptions in sleep patterns, influencing not only physical health and wellness however likewise mental well-being. When an individual pees way too much throughout the daytime, yet can restrict the amount of trips to the shower room during the night, it's referred to as frequent peeing. Nocturia is strictly utilizing the shower room numerous times after bedtime and prior to you awaken in the morning. Some people with nighttime polyuria additionally have reduced bladder capacity, indicating that their bladder does not have enough "storage space" for the amount of urine being produced. A variety of points can trigger low bladder ability, including infections and inflammation. Additionally, there can be clearing problems because of clog. The sources of nocturia differ, and individuals could have one or a mix of the issues. Tracking how much you drink, in addition to exactly how often and how much you urinate, can assist you determine what's creating you to pee so much during the night. It can additionally be practical to track your weight at the exact same time everyday, using the exact same range.

Going through giving birth, smoking or being overweight can elevate the danger of stress and anxiety urinary incontinence for women, Wright claims. Anxiety urinary incontinence in men is unusual, and when it emerges, it's usually as a result of prostate cancer cells treatment, such as radiation or surgical treatment. Throughout deep sleep, our bodies produce antidiuretic hormonal agents. People with sleep apnea don't enter the deep stages of sleep, so their bodies don't make enough of this hormone. Furthermore, the drops in oxygen levels during apnea episodes set off kidneys to excrete even more water.
